Activities - how the charity spends its money
The organisation believes it has potential to help ethnic minority communities in deprived areas to further develop themselves in education, health and integration. The future plans would be to expand the organisation to other areas where there is a need for such a community led charity organisation which aims to reach out to young people and families who are currently deprived of facilities.

Charitable objects
THE CHARITY WORKS F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T TO ADVANCE THE EDUCATION OF CHILDREN, THEIR FAMILIES AND CARERS IN VARYING SUBJECTS INCLUDING BUT NOT LIMITED TO ENGLISH, MATHS, ESOL AND DEBT MANAGEMENT
